User Interaction Aware Reinforcement Learning for Power and Thermal Efficiency of CPU-GPU Mobile MPSoCs
Mobile user’s usage behaviour changes throughout the day and the desirable Quality of Service (QoS) could thus change for each session. In this paper, we propose a QoS aware agent to monitor mobile user’s usage behaviour to find the target frame rate, which satisfies the desired user’s QoS, and applies reinforcement learning based DVFS on a CPU-GPU MPSoC to satisfy the frame rate requirement. Experimental study on a real Exynos hardware platform shows that our proposed agent is able to achieve a maximum of 50% power saving and 29% reduction in peak temperature compared to stock Android’s power saving scheme. It also outperforms the existing state-of-the-art power and thermal management scheme by 41% and 19%, respectively
